Second foal out of Black Caviar to stand for $4,400
Prince Of Caviar (Sebring), the second foal out of Black Caviar (Bel Esprit) will stand at Riverbank Farm in Victoria for a fee of $4,400 (inc GST) this year.
Trained by Michael, Wayne and John Hawkes, the son of Sebring (More Than Ready) won once and was placed three times from six career starts and then was retired due to injury. He is one of two winners, Oscietra (Exceed And Excel) the other, out of champion Black Caviar who is herself a half-sister to four-time Group 1 winner and Vinery Stud-based sire All Too Hard (Casino Prince) being out of Helsinge (Desert Sun).
Prince Of Caviar's third dam is Scandinavia (Snippets) who in turn produced Galaxy Handicap (Gr 1, 1100m) winner and sire Magnus (Flying Spur) and his Group winning half-brother Wilander (Exceed And Excel).
